Only local candidates will be considered. Veteran and retired candidates welcome! Job Description: We are seeking a highly skilled and experienced Welder III to join our team in Norfolk, VA . This position is responsible for performing complex welding tasks in support of ship repair and maritime fabrication projects.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in structural and pipe welding, a deep understanding of shipbuilding materials and techniques, and experience working in a shipyard or maritime industrial environment.
The successful candidate will join our Fleet Services Group, performing various ship repair, modernization, and Alteration Installation Team (AIT) projects in support of U.S. Navy and commercial maritime clients. This role requires precision, efficiency, and a commitment to quality workmanship in both shop and shipboard environments. Essential duties & responsibilities include, but are not limited to the following:
- Join, fabricate, and repair metal and other weldable material by applying appropriate welding techniques.
- Perform various welding processes to repair, modify and install various pipes, structures, foundations and fittings associated with shipboard hydraulic, pneumatic and water systems.
- Fabricate and install fixtures and jigs required for welding process alignments.
- Interpret blueprints, specifications, diagrams or schematics to determine appropriate welding process.
- Select required welding filler materials, joint design, heat ranges and most effective or required welding process/procedure to ensure quality welding operations IAW TWD.
- Inspect completed welds to determine structural soundness and adherence to NAVSEA, ABS & AWS standards.
- Install or repairs equipment, such as pipes, valves, floors and tank linings.
- Clamp, hold, tack-weld, heat-bend, grind or bolt component parts to obtain required configurations and positions for welding.
- Operate manual or semi-automatic welding equipment to fuse basic metal segments, using processes such as flux-cored arc, carbon arc, etc.
- Weld multiple types, thicknesses & sizes of pipe, plate & bar material in horizontal, overhead and/or vertical positions.
- Document objective quality evidence to the requisite Continental Tide Forms.
- Demonstrate the ability to estimate a drawing package / installation.
- Utilize the following: SMAW, GMAW & GTAW, Ship Fitting and OXY ACC & Propane GAS Cutting torch.
- Provides leadership to technical project teams, oversees scheduling and task execution, and delivers regular updates and briefings to both customers and/or senior leadership
